.. |Icon_Add_Clone| image:: /images/Icon_Add_Clone.png :scale: 100 % #################################### Clone Tool |Icon_Add_Clone| #################################### Clones the selected polygons along the line drawn by dragging a mouse. Pressing ``SPACE`` confirms the clone action and ``ESC`` cancels it. Steps - Single Clone --------------------- 1. Enter Clone tool. 2. Point at a polygon you want to clone by putting the mouse over it if polygons are not selected when this tool is activated. 3. Drag the mouse to draw a line. You can make sure that the cloned polygons will be aligned with the line. 4. Adjust ``Number``, ``Distance`` and ``Arrangement`` in ``Properties`` if necessary. 5. Press ``SPACE`` or click on ``Confirm`` button to confirm, or Press ``ESC`` or click on ``Cancel`` button to cancel. Steps - Multi Clone --------------------- 1. Select Several polygons using ``Polygon Tool`` 2. Enter Clone tool. 3. Drag the mouse to draw a line. You can make sure that the cloned polygons will be aligned with the line. 4. Adjust ``Number``, ``Distance`` and ``Arrangement`` in ``Properties`` if necessary. 5. Press ``SPACE`` or click on ``Confirm`` button to confirm, or Press ``ESC`` or click on ``Cancel`` button to cancel. Interface --------------- ``LMB Drag`` Draws an edge where the clones will be placed. Properties --------------- Number The number of clones Distance The distance of an edge where the clones will be placed. Arrangement * ``Divide`` - Creates clones arranged evenly between the starting point and the end point of the edge. * ``Multiply`` - Makes clones along the edge.
